New Delhi: In the month of November, the common man is getting relief in the prices of petrol and diesel. Indian oil companies (IOC, HPCL & BPCL) have not made any change in the prices of petrol-diesel on Tuesday. Fuel prices have remained the same for more than a month. Due to COVID-19 due to economic crisis and subsequent revenue pressure, the Center can again increase the excise duty on petrol and diesel. Sources indicated that if the government felt the need to raise more resources to finance additional economic reform packages to fight the corona-related disruptions, the excise duty on petrol and diesel would be hiked by Rs 3-6 per litre soon.

There is a change in the prices of petrol and diesel at six in the morning. The new rates are applicable from six o'clock in the morning. After adding excise duty, dealer commission and other things, the price of petrol and diesel almost doubles. Petrol and diesel prices change every day depending on what the prices of crude are in the international market along with foreign exchange rates.

Know the cost of today's petrol diesel in big cities of the country -
Delhi Petrol is Rs 81.06 and Diesel is Rs 70.46 per litre.
The price of petrol is Rs 87.74 and diesel is Rs 76.86 per litre in Mumbai.
Kolkata petrol is Rs 82.59 and diesel is Rs 73.99 per litre.
Chennai Petrol costs Rs 84.14 and diesel is Rs 75.95 per litre.
Noida petrol is Rs 81.58 and diesel is Rs 70.00 per litre.
Lucknow petrol is Rs 81.48 and diesel is Rs 70.91 per litre.
Patna petrol is Rs 73.73 and diesel is Rs 76.10 per litre.
Chandigarh Petrol is Rs 77.99 and diesel is Rs 70.17 per litre.
